Today I started out with a dozen photos of my daughter and wanted to create
some 10x15cm (4x6") prints to put in a (real paper) album. Before deciding
which images to use for the large prints I wanted to create a thumbnail preview
page with all photos to print out.

But the state of the current print dialog (digikam-6.0-20180727 appimage) is
just so bad that I wasn't able to generate any sensible results. Please don't
take this personally, I'm taking time to describe all issues in detail so we
can fix them and think of improvements. Some are (probably) trivial and
straight forward, some might require some thinking.

So, here we go:

1. The print dialog opens in a tiny window where almost nothing is visible. See
attached screenshot #1. You have to resize this window before being able to do
anything. What's more, the window size isn't remembered when using the print
dialog multiple times.
=> Please choose a sensible default size that avoids most scrollbars and where
all elements are readable. 860x650 seems to be a good choice on my computer,
but this might depend on screen fonts and so on.

2. The print dialog always takes all images of the current album by default. It
should only use *visible* images (there might be a properties filter and
grouped images) or *selected* images by default. This works once, but if you go
back and forth a couple times in the assistant the list of images is suddenly
extended to contain all images of the current album.
I'm not sure about this, I could not reproduce it always, but there was
something weird going on.

3. If you choose a thumbnail overview print layout and have a lot of (~50)
images selected for inclusion, the application freezes for >10 seconds when it
is generating thumbnails (I suppose) for the preview. There should be a kind of
progress dialog or the thumbnail should be generated asynchronously. Users will
assume Digikam has crashed. And, why is Digikam not using the thumbnails from
the main view? This should be much faster.

4. When removing images from the list (on the assistant page where you choose
the paper layout) *using the right mouse button context menu* instead of the
buttons, the images are not really removed - they stay on the thumbnail layout.
But they are not in the list either.

5. With all the available dark themes (Black Body, Darkroom, Grey Card, ...),
the button icons and labels are completely invisible. This is a generic issue
with Digikam on Ubuntu, so maybe there is a generic solution? Also the borders
of checkboxes are almost invisible.

6. The crop option in the print assistant does not allow zooming in/out to
further fine tune the area of the image to be printed. Or am I missing
something? There is no obvious way to zoom.

7. The crop selection rectangle behaves weird - it seems it can only be grabbed
at the center and then jumps around if you grab it any other position. It
should be possible to grab it at any position and drag it around.

8. There is no (obvious?) way of saving / repeating the crop position and size
for multiple images, which is an important use case when you have dozens of
almost identical portraits and want to create a thubmnail overview printout.

9. It would be a very nice feature if the crop window could autoadjust / zoom
to encompass all available face rectangles (and associated heads if fully on
the image) - and if only a single face rectangle exists, try to put it in a
special position (e.g. the 3x3 crosshair crossing points).

10. It would be a plus if the print creator's crop position would be saved with
the image and reused if the print creator would later be called up again.

11. It would be a plus if images could be reordered and also removed during
cropping, since this allows for a more detailed preview than the other
assistant's steps.

12. It would be a plus if not only the crop rectangle could be zommed in or
out, but also the image itself - to have a quick look at image details again.

13. Sometimes the thumbnail order in the print preview, and in the crop
preview, did not equal the thumbnail order that was set in the list. This is
especially true if the user went forwards and backwards multiple times in the
assistant.

14. In the preview list of images, there is no (obvious?) way of (re)sorting
images based on metadata - e.g. time, filename, comment or tag(s).

15. There seems to be no (obvious?) way to set the white margin around each
image in the thumbnail print layout. This would be a plus.

16. When the user goes back in the assistant and then returns to the caption
settings, images in the list will be duplicated (added again). This should not
happen. Instead, Digikam could offer a button "Reset list" above the list in
the button bar.
